Another feature that I appreciate is the improved motion of the AT-AT model. This edition boasts adjustments made to the legs, which offer a fuller range of motion in the knees and hips. The articulation of all four legs, along with a spring assembly for the neck, enhances the playability and display potential of the model. It’s not just a static object; it’s a dynamic representation of the AT-AT that can be posed in various ways to evoke the feeling of an epic battle scene right in my living room.
When it comes to the technical specifications, the model is 8 inches tall and comprises 77 parts, making it a manageable yet engaging project for someone with a bit of modeling experience. Rated at a skill level of 2, it’s suitable for ages 10 and up, making it an excellent choice for both younger enthusiasts and adults who cherish the nostalgia of Star Wars. Choosing the Right Scale
One of the first decisions I faced was the scale of the model. Different scales can significantly affect the level of detail and the complexity of the assembly. I found that larger scales, such as 1:144 or 1:72, often allow for more intricate detailing but can require more space for display. Conversely, smaller scales might be easier to handle and store but may sacrifice some detail. I recommend considering my available space and the amount of time I want to invest in building.

Painting and Finishing Touches
Painting the model is where I could truly express my creativity. I discovered that using high-quality paints designed for plastic models provided the best results. I also experimented with different techniques, such as dry brushing and weathering, to add depth and realism. I suggest practicing these techniques on scrap pieces first to build my confidence before applying them to the main model.
